How much do packing assembly jobs pay per hour?

As of Aug 8, 2026, the average hourly pay for packing assembly in Illinois is $15.61, according to ZipRecruiter salary data. Most workers in this role earn between $13.99 and $16.78 per hour, depending on experience, location, and employer.

Is packing a hard job?

Packing as an assembly job involves repetitive tasks such as sorting, wrapping, and labeling products, which can be physically demanding but generally do not require advanced skills. Attention to detail and the ability to work efficiently are important, and the work environment is often fast-paced. The difficulty level varies depending on the specific workplace and workload.

What are the key skills and qualifications needed to thrive as a packing assembly worker?

To thrive as a Packing Assembly worker, you need strong attention to detail, manual dexterity, and a basic understanding of safety and quality standards, often supported by a high school diploma or equivalent. Familiarity with packing machinery, conveyor belts, and inventory tracking systems is typically required. Reliability, teamwork, and the ability to work efficiently under time constraints are important soft skills in this role. These skills ensure products are accurately assembled and packaged, maintaining production quality and meeting shipping deadlines.

What is a packing assembly?

Packing assembly jobs involve preparing products for shipment by assembling, packaging, and labeling items in a manufacturing or warehouse environment. Workers may inspect products for quality, assemble packaging materials, and ensure that items are securely packed to prevent damage during transport. These roles often require attention to detail, the ability to follow instructions, and some physical stamina, as the work can involve standing for long periods and lifting packages. Packing assembly jobs are essential in industries such as food production, electronics, and retail distribution.

What are some common challenges faced in a packing assembly role, and how can they be managed?

In a Packing Assembly role, common challenges include maintaining speed and accuracy during repetitive tasks, adapting to changing product lines, and ensuring quality control under tight deadlines. Managing these challenges often involves staying organized, following standardized procedures, and communicating effectively with team members and supervisors. Many employers provide on-the-job training and encourage teamwork to help new hires acclimate quickly and maintain high productivity.

Machine Operator - Plastics Position Overview
The Machine Operators maintain the operation of injection molding equipment. This includes but is not limited to assembly of components, inspection of parts, and packing proper quantities to customer specified requirements.
Machine Operator - Plastics Essential Functions
  • Set up, operate, and monitor machinery according to provided guidelines and specifications.
  • Inspect for defects, reporting any findings to appropriate personnel.
  • Follow verbal and written instructions.
  • Packing.
  • Maintaining clean and safe workspace.

Machine Operator - Plastics Required Experience
  • Ability to learn other line jobs to serve as utility person for breaks and lunch.
  • Ability to work overtime as required.
  • Experience with or ability to do intricate hand assembly on fast paced assembly line.
  • Possess good eye-hand coordination for assembly purposes.

Machine Operator - Plastics Physical Demands and Work Environment
  • Prolonged standing as required during press and assembly operations.
  • Ability to reach into injection-molding press with both hands to remove product required.
  • Ability to stoop, bend, twist or turn to move product from press and/or assembly areas to other plant locations required.
  • Required lifting and/or moving up to 30 pounds on a repetitive basis.
  • Ability to read applicable instructions.
  • The employee is frequently exposed to moving mechanical parts.
